The thing with this book was that at first I liked everything but the male character, which was a problem considering he was the love interest. I liked the protagonist and I could relate to her, I liked her family and her story and her boss, I really liked her boss. But I haven't felt this exasperated with a male protagonist since I've read Mara Dyer. Oh boy, was this frustrating. And setting aside my dislike for the character, I could talk about his relationship with Lucy, who was such a cool character, that became needy and possessive and that's not the type of romantic relationship I'm here for.
